Toddler fights for life after Wexford accident

03/08/2003 - 09:00:29
A road traffic accident which killed a baby girl, has left her three-year-old brother fighting for his life.

The boy was seriously injured when his family car collided with a lorry at Ashfield Cross on the main Rosslare to Wexford road yesterday morning.

The lorry is thought to have crashed into the back of the vehicle, instantly killing the 18-month-old girl.

The Dublin family had been on holidays in Co Wexford. The three-year-old boy is in a critical condition in Dublin's Beaumont Hospital.
